Webexecutable file (exe file): An executable file (exe file) is a computer file that contains an encoded sequence of instructions that the system can execute directly when the user clicks the file icon. Run the following command to … Web2 dagen geleden · Some Windows apps may need administrator privileges to work correctly. To fix the error, run the app as an administrator. If it works, you can configure the app properties to always run as administrator. To run an app as an administrator: Right-click on the app icon and select Run as administrator. Click Yes if prompted by User Account … Web7 dec. 2024 · Press Windows + R, type powershell, and press Ctrl + Shift + Enter to launch PowerShell as administrator. If your file is already in the same directory, type & ‘.\.exe’ and press Enter. Web16 mrt. 2024 · You can follow these steps to open an executable file in Windows: Open your search bar and type in the name of the executable file you're looking for. When it appears, you can double-click the file name. This opens the file. This causes the program to display its own window with further instructions.
